Andre G. Journel's Resume
Andre G. Journel
Professor of Petroleum Engineering
YEAR AND PLACE OF BIRTH:
EDUCATION:
- 1967 B.S. Mining Engineering, Ecole Nat. Sup. Mines, Nancy , France
- 1974 DS2 Economic Geology, University of Nancy
- 1977 DSc Applied Math: Geostatistics, University of Nancy
P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E:
- 1969-73 Mining Project Engineer, Centre de Morphologie Mathematique
- 1973-78 Maitre de Recherches, Centre de Geostatistique, Paris School of Mines
- 1978-79 Visiting Associate Professor of Applied Earth Sciences, Stanford
University
- 1979-86 Associate Professor of Applied Earth Sciences, Stanford University
- 1986-1992 Chairman, Applied Earth Sciences, Stanford University
- 1987-1992 Professor of Applied Earth Sciences, Stanford University
- 1992-present Professor of Petroleum Engineering
and Professor of Geological & Environmental Sciences,
Stanford University
HONORS AND AWARDS:
- 1983 Director, 2nd World Institute on "Geostatistics," sponsored by NATO
- 1986 Founding member, North American Council on Geostatistics
- 1989 Krumbein Medal, Mathematical Geology
- 1992 Opening Keynote Speaker, 23rd APCOM Congress
- 1993 Keynote Speaker, Geostatistics for the Next Century Symposium
- 1994 Donald and Donald M. Steel Professor of Earth Sciences, Stanford
University
- 1995 School of Earth Sciences Teaching Award
- 1996 Opening Keynote Speaker, 5th International Geostat. Congress
- 1998 Anthony F. Lucas Medal, Society of Petroleum Engineers
- 1998 Elected Member, National Academy of Engineering
